STC429651 Death of Prince William, son of Henry I, engraved by J. Stow, illustration from David Humes The History of England, pub. by R. Bowyer, London, 1812 (engraving) by Rigaud, John Francis (1742-1810) (after); Private Collection; (add.info.: The death of William Adelin (1103-1120), son and heir of Henry I of England, who drowned in the sinking of the White Ship; ); The Stapleton Collection; French, out of copyright

This print captures a tragic moment in history - the death of Prince William, son of Henry I. Engraved by J. Stow and featured in David Humes' The History of England, this illustration takes us back to London in 1812. The image portrays the aftermath of the devastating sinking of the White Ship, where young William Adelin met his untimely demise. As we gaze upon this engraving by John Francis Rigaud, we cannot help but feel a sense of sorrow and loss. The scene is set against the backdrop of a stormy sea, symbolizing the turbulent fate that awaited Prince William on that fateful night. The wreckage lies scattered across the water's surface as a haunting reminder of lives lost too soon. Intricately detailed, every element tells its own story - from the grief-stricken faces of those left behind to the regal presence surrounding them. This tragedy not only shook Great Britain but also left an indelible mark on English history.
